DOCUMENTATION = r'''
---
module: bigip_message_routing_protocol
short_description: Manage generic message parser profile.
description:
- Manages generic message parser profile for use with the message routing framework.
version_added: 2.9
options:
name:
description:
- Specifies the name of the generic parser profile.
required: True
type: str
description:
description:
- The user defined description of the generic parser profile.
type: str
parent:
description:
- The parent template of this parser profile. Once this value has been set, it cannot be changed.
- When creating a new profile, if this parameter is not specified,
the default is the system-supplied C(genericmsg) profile.
type: str
disable_parser:
description:
- When C(yes), the generic message parser will be disabled ignoring all incoming packets and not directly
send message data.
- This mode supports iRule script protocol implementations that will generate messages from the incoming transport
stream and send outgoing messages on the outgoing transport stream.
type: bool
max_egress_buffer:
description:
- Specifies the maximum size of the send buffer in bytes. If the number of bytes in the send buffer for a
connection exceeds this value, the generic message protocol will stop receiving outgoing messages from the
router until the size of the size of the buffer drops below this setting.
- The accepted range is between 0 and 4294967295 inclusive.
type: int
max_msg_size:
description:
- Specifies the maximum size of a received message. If a message exceeds this size, the connection will be reset.
- The accepted range is between 0 and 4294967295 inclusive.
type: int
msg_terminator:
description:
- The string of characters used to terminate a message. If the message-terminator is not specified,
the generic message parser will not separate the input stream into messages.
type: str
no_response:
description:
- When set, matching of responses to requests is disabled.
type: bool
partition:
description:
- Device partition to create route object on.
type: str
default: Common
state:
description:
- When C(present), ensures that the route exists.
- When C(absent), ensures the route is removed.
type: str
choices:
- present
- absent
default: present
notes:
- Requires BIG-IP >= 14.0.0
extends_documentation_fragment: f5
author:
- Wojciech Wypior (@wojtek0806)
'''
EXAMPLES = r'''
- name: Create a generic parser
bigip_message_routing_protocol:
name: foo
description: 'This is parser'
no_response: yes
provider:
password: secret
server: lb.mydomain.com
user: admin
delegate_to: localhost
- name: Modify a generic parser
bigip_message_routing_protocol:
name: foo
no_response: no
max_egress_buffer: 10000
max_msg_size: 2000
provider:
password: secret
server: lb.mydomain.com
user: admin
delegate_to: localhost
- name: Remove generic parser
bigip_message_routing_protocol:
name: foo
state: absent
provider:
password: secret
server: lb.mydomain.com
user: admin
delegate_to: localhost
'''
